Understanding the Significance of SGW

The Security Gateway Module (SGW) acts as a virtual fortress within FCA vehicles, safeguarding their intricate networks and critical systems. Far from being a mere barrier, the SGW's primary role is to thwart unauthorized access and manipulations, ensuring the integrity and security of the vehicle's operations. Importantly, FCA clarifies that the SGW is not designed to impede legitimate diagnostic activities but rather to curtail the capabilities of unregistered and unauthenticated users, especially when it comes to intrusive diagnostics involving two-way controls.

This proactive security measure covers a range of functions, including bidirectional operations such as calibration, relearn, and actuation. Even seemingly innocuous tasks like code clearance are restricted. FCA has, as of 2020, embraced SGW technology in nearly 100% of their vehicle production, underscoring its importance in contemporary automotive security.

Unlocking SGW with Autel Tablet User Registration AutoAuth

The gateway to accessing SGW and performing previously restricted operations lies in Autel's AutoAuth service. To facilitate this, users of Autel tablets must engage in a straightforward registration process, ensuring both themselves and their scanning devices are enlisted in AutoAuth.

Here are the key steps:

Registration: To begin, navigate to https://webapp.autoauth.com and create a user account, a simple and cost-free endeavor.

Service Center Registration/Independent Technician Registration: The next step involves creating an account for Service Centers or Independent Technicians, which entails a nominal annual fee of $50. This registration allows you to include up to 6 users and affords the capacity to register up to 100 tools at no extra charge. For those requiring additional users, an increment of $2 per user is applied.

Stay Updated: Ensure your Autel tablet scanner maintains an active update subscription from Autel. Keeping the software up to date is pivotal to ensuring smooth functionality.

Ensuring Seamless SGW Access

For Autel tablet users, a few additional considerations are vital for uninterrupted SGW access:

Online Autel Account: Maintain your Autel account online at all times to receive the latest software updates and information.

Internet Connectivity: Your Autel tablet scanner must have a stable internet connection to communicate with the FCA SGW authentication system, allowing it to send requests and receive permissions to bypass the Security Gateway module.
